diff --git a/Dockerfile b/Dockerfile index 596f57f5..3c1e8528 100644 --- a/Dockerfile +++ b/Dockerfile @@ -31,4 +31,4 @@ RUN yum install -y kde-l10n-Chinese &&\ ENV LANG zh_CN.UTF-8 ENV LC_ALL zh_CN.UTF-8 ENV KKFILEVIEW_BIN_FOLDER /opt/kkFileView-2.2.0-SNAPSHOT/bin -ENTRYPOINT ["java","-Dfile.encoding=UTF-8","-Dsun.java2d.cmm=sun.java2d.cmm.kcms.KcmsServiceProvider","-Dspring.config.location=/opt/kkFileView-2.2.0-SNAPSHOT/conf/application.properties","-jar","/opt/kkFileView-2.2.0-SNAPSHOT/bin/kkFileView-2.2.0-SNAPSHOT.jar"] \ No newline at end of file +ENTRYPOINT ["java","-Dfile.encoding=UTF-8","-Dsun.java2d.cmm=sun.java2d.cmm.kcms.KcmsServiceProvider","-Dspring.config.location=/opt/kkFileView-2.2.0-SNAPSHOT/config/application.properties","-jar","/opt/kkFileView-2.2.0-SNAPSHOT/bin/kkFileView-2.2.0-SNAPSHOT.jar"] \ No newline at end of file diff --git a/jodconverter-core/src/main/java/org/artofsolving/jodconverter/office/OfficeUtils.java b/jodconverter-core/src/main/java/org/artofsolving/jodconverter/office/OfficeUtils.java index f734707f..e6ab33ef 100644 --- a/jodconverter-core/src/main/java/org/artofsolving/jodconverter/office/OfficeUtils.java +++ b/jodconverter-core/src/main/java/org/artofsolving/jodconverter/office/OfficeUtils.java @@ -143,7 +143,7 @@ public class OfficeUtils { public static String getCustomizedConfigPath() { String homePath = OfficeUtils.getHomePath(); String separator = java.io.File.separator; - String configFilePath = homePath + separator + "conf" + separator + "application.properties"; + String configFilePath = homePath + separator + "config" + separator + "application.properties"; return configFilePath; } diff --git a/jodconverter-web/pom.xml b/jodconverter-web/pom.xml index 736e418d..ef297e1c 100644 --- a/jodconverter-web/pom.xml +++ b/jodconverter-web/pom.xml @@ -194,7 +194,7 @@ true - src/main/conf + src/main/config ${build.exclude.resource} @@ -210,7 +210,7 @@ false - src/main/resources/assembly.xml + src/main/assembly/assembly.xml diff --git a/jodconverter-web/src/main/resources/assembly.xml b/jodconverter-web/src/main/assembly/assembly.xml similarity index 75% rename from jodconverter-web/src/main/resources/assembly.xml rename to jodconverter-web/src/main/assembly/assembly.xml index ee80fa17..647ad580 100644 --- a/jodconverter-web/src/main/resources/assembly.xml +++ b/jodconverter-web/src/main/assembly/assembly.xml @@ -11,18 +11,24 @@ true - src/main/conf - ${file.separator}conf + src/main/bin + ${file.separator}bin + + *.sh + + 755 + unix src/main/bin ${file.separator}bin - 755 + + *.bat + - src/main/script - ${file.separator}script - 755 + src/main/config + ${file.separator}config src/main/log diff --git a/jodconverter-web/src/main/script/install.sh b/jodconverter-web/src/main/bin/install.sh similarity index 100% rename from jodconverter-web/src/main/script/install.sh rename to jodconverter-web/src/main/bin/install.sh diff --git a/jodconverter-web/src/main/bin/startup.bat b/jodconverter-web/src/main/bin/startup.bat index 616d4d5c..0a5acfbb 100644 --- a/jodconverter-web/src/main/bin/startup.bat +++ b/jodconverter-web/src/main/bin/startup.bat @@ -3,7 +3,7 @@ set "KKFILEVIEW_BIN_FOLDER=%cd%" cd "%KKFILEVIEW_BIN_FOLDER%" echo Using KKFILEVIEW_BIN_FOLDER %KKFILEVIEW_BIN_FOLDER% echo Starting kkFileView... -echo Please check log file in ./log/kkFileView.log for more information +echo Please check log file in ../log/kkFileView.log for more information echo You can get help in our official homesite: https://kkFileView.keking.cn -echo If this project is helpful to you, please star it in https://gitee.com/kekingcn/file-online-preview -java -Dsun.java2d.cmm=sun.java2d.cmm.kcms.KcmsServiceProvider -Dspring.config.location=..\conf\application.properties -jar kkFileView-2.2.0-SNAPSHOT.jar -> ..\log\kkFileView.log \ No newline at end of file +echo If this project is helpful to you, please star it on https://gitee.com/kekingcn/file-online-preview/stargazers +java -Dsun.java2d.cmm=sun.java2d.cmm.kcms.KcmsServiceProvider -Dspring.config.location=..\config\application.properties -jar kkFileView-2.2.0-SNAPSHOT.jar -> ..\log\kkFileView.log \ No newline at end of file diff --git a/jodconverter-web/src/main/bin/startup.sh b/jodconverter-web/src/main/bin/startup.sh index c9cf8e20..f30e44f6 100644 --- a/jodconverter-web/src/main/bin/startup.sh +++ b/jodconverter-web/src/main/bin/startup.sh @@ -20,7 +20,7 @@ else done if [ ! -n "${FLAG}" ]; then echo "Installing OpenOffice" - sh ../script/install.sh + sh ./install.sh else echo "Detected office component has been installed in $OFFICE_HOME" fi @@ -28,5 +28,5 @@ fi echo "Starting kkFileView..." echo "Please execute ./showlog.sh to check log for more information" echo "You can get help in our official homesite: https://kkFileView.keking.cn" -echo "If this project is helpful to you, please star it in https://gitee.com/kekingcn/file-online-preview" -nohup java -Dfile.encoding=UTF-8 -Dsun.java2d.cmm=sun.java2d.cmm.kcms.KcmsServiceProvider -Dspring.config.location=../conf/application.properties -jar kkFileView-2.2.0-SNAPSHOT.jar > ../log/kkFileView.log 2>&1 & +echo "If this project is helpful to you, please star it on https://gitee.com/kekingcn/file-online-preview/stargazers" +nohup java -Dfile.encoding=UTF-8 -Dsun.java2d.cmm=sun.java2d.cmm.kcms.KcmsServiceProvider -Dspring.config.location=../config/application.properties -jar kkFileView-2.2.0-SNAPSHOT.jar > ../log/kkFileView.log 2>&1 & diff --git a/jodconverter-web/src/main/conf/application.properties b/jodconverter-web/src/main/config/application.properties similarity index 100% rename from jodconverter-web/src/main/conf/application.properties rename to jodconverter-web/src/main/config/application.properties diff --git a/jodconverter-web/src/main/resources/META-INF/app.properties b/jodconverter-web/src/main/resources/META-INF/app.properties deleted file mode 100644 index ca9d3a6d..00000000 --- a/jodconverter-web/src/main/resources/META-INF/app.properties +++ /dev/null @@ -1 +0,0 @@ -app.id=file-preview